Want to get the most out of your daily "grind"? Here are five drinks that are sure to boost your energy level.

Stumptown Cold Brew + Chocolate Milk

Find Stumptown brand drinks at Target, they're highly caffeinated and delicious. Stumptown Chocolate is rich, sweet, and the most highly caffeinated of the brand's drinks. 340 mg of caffeine for the win!

Chameleon Cold Brew

12 ounces, 270 mg of caffeine. Make sure to find the ready to drink version, otherwise you will have to dilute it.

Starbucks Iced Coffee

Grande size, lightly sweetened (or unsweetened, if you have no soul like me). 165 mg of caffeine. Straight and to the point!

Starbucks Iced Latte

Despite the hype over espresso drinks being highly caffeinated, shots tend to have less caffeine than just plain coffee. However, iced lattes are still a good way to get your daily dose of energy (150 mg of caffeine for a grande size). Add caramel or vanilla flavor for something sweet!

Any Smoothie at Jamba Juice + Green Energy Boost

For those that don't love coffee, but need the extra energy. The energy boost adds 120 mg of caffeine to any smoothie.
